United States District Court SOUTHERN DISTRICT OF CALIFORNIA Jessica Martinez-Lopez, Petitioner Civil Action No. 17cv2473-CAB(BLM) v. Jefferson B. Sessions III, et al. JUDGMENT IN A CIVIL CASE Respondents. Decision by Court. This action came to trial or hearing before the Court. The issues have been tried or heard and a decision has been rendered.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ED AND ADJUDGED: The Court finds the Petition for Writ of Habeas Corpus is granted. It is further ordered: 1. Within 14 days of this order, Respondents must provide Petitioner a hearing before an IJ in which the government bears the burden to demonstrate that Petitioner is either a flight risk or a danger to society; 2. If the government fails to show that Petitioner poses either a danger or a flight risk, the IJ shall set a reasonable bond for Petitioner’s release pending the conclusion of her withholding of removal and CAT case.
